Analysis

Tajikistan recorded 653,503 kg for mules and asses — manure left on pasture that leaches in 2023.

That represents a change of down 6.1% on the previous year and down 39.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, mules and asses — manure left on pasture that leaches in Tajikistan peaked at 1.12 million kg in 2010 and was at its lowest, 393,770 kg, in 1992.

Tajikistan ranks 37th of 125 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 32 years of available data.

The Livestock Manure domain of FAOSTAT contains estimates of nitrogen (N) inputs to agricultural soils from livestock manure. Data on the N losses to air and water are also disseminated. These estimates are compiled using official FAOSTAT statistics of animal stocks and by applying the internationally approved Guidelines of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C). Data are available by country, with global coverage and updated annually.The following elements are disseminated: 1) Stocks; 2) Amount excreted in manure (N content); 3) Manure left on pasture (N content); 4) Manure left on pasture that volatilises (N content); 5) Manure left on pasture that leaches (N content); 6) Manure treated (N content); 7) Losses from manure treated (N content); 8) Manure applied to soils (N content); 9) Manure applied to soils that volatilises (N content); 10) Manure applied to soils that leaches (N content).
